WebOct 18, 2024 · A T-score between -1 and -2.5 is defined as osteopenia or low bone mass. A T-score of -2.5 or below is defined as osteoporosis. You may hear someone refer to having, for example, osteoporosis -2.5 or osteoporosis -3, which indicates the degree of their osteoporosis. Z-Score: The Z-score compares your bone mineral density with other … WebHere’s the interpretation of the T-score as per the World Health Organization: T-score of -1 or more is indicative of normal bone density. This implies that bone density is normal when the T-score within 1 standard deviation (+1 or -1) of the normal value in a healthy young adult. T-score between -1 and -2.5 is indicative of osteopenia.

Denosumab is delivered via a shot under the skin every six months. Similar to bisphosphonates, denosumab has the same rare complication of causing breaks or … WebStandardization of BMD. The three manufacturers of DEXA equipment do not give STANDARDIZED RESULTS. The differences are clinically important, making it difficult to compare a measurement made from one machine to the other. For example, the hip bone density on a Lunar scan is about 6% higher than on a Hologic scan.

WebWhat do bone mineral density test results mean? After a DEXA scan, a T-score is given for each site measured (usually hip and spine): A score of -1 or higher means that you have normal bone density. A score of -1 to -2.5 means that you have a low BMD and are at increased risk of osteoporosis. WebOct 29, 2024 · T-scores between -1 and -2.5 indicate that a person has low bone mass, but it’s not quite low enough for them to be diagnosed with osteoporosis. A diagnosis of osteoporosis is made if a person’s T-score is -2.5 or lower. The lower a person’s T-score, the more severe their bone loss is, and the more at risk for fractures they are. 1.
